S & E Delivery Arvada CO - Hours of Operation

S & E Delivery Address

5810 Lamar St # 1,
Arvada CO 80003-5665
(303) 422-2222

0 REVIEW

Add Review | Edit

S & E Delivery Store Hours

This location's hours may fluctuate, so please contact the store for exact store hours.

QR Address

QR Phone

Nearby S & E Delivery Locations Miles
View More

S & E Delivery - Arvada has 0 reviews

Be the first to share your comments with others about
S & E Delivery - Arvada.


Write a Review


Other cities with S & E Delivery : | S & E Delivery in Arvada